A Preliminary Study on Peroxidase Isoenzyme of the Decline of Armand Pine Forests Infected by Aphid Mite
-
-
Abstract
The variations of peroxidase isoenzyme (POI) and enzyme activity in the root, stem and leaf tissues of Pinus armandii infected by Cinara were studied by using polyacrylamide gel.electrophoresis.The result showed that root, stem and leaf tissues infected by Cinara had higher POD activity than those of the healthy plant did, and the mumbers of band were increased.The higher the disease level the plant had, the higher the enzymatic activity and the more the band mumbers the root, stem and leaf tissues had.Comparing the healthy plant with inhealthy infected by aphid, the peroxidase enzymatic of root and stem tissues is larger than leaf tissues.
